Environmental Levy is fixed: Studio - $9.50, One bedroom - $15.00, 2 bedroom - $25.00. Weekly fee.

Occupancy Tax which is charged on all occupied rooms in addition to Environmental tax: Studio - $9.50, One bedroom - $10.28, 2 bedroom - $11.88. Daily fee.

Ok, yes there is a separate check in for anyone staying in the Spyglass building. According to the front desk, the Surf Club assigns the units prior to your arrival. They email you a few weeks in advance asking for your preference. Upon your arrival changes can be made according to what is available in the building where they have assigned you. The second check in desk is only open from 10:00 AM to 6:00 PM. Anyone assigned to Spyglass arriving after 6 PM, is assisted at the Surf Club front desk. The bellmen transport your luggage to the Spyglass building.
